Effective Date:\t3/1/2024 Job Summary: The Loan Servicing Clerk is responsible for servicing all loans post-closing to include consumer, mortgage, and commercial. They will be responsible for maintaining and monitoring the construction loan portfolio and will be responsible for managing mortgage loans sold through the secondary market.
Supervisory Responsibilities: None
Duties/Responsibilities:
\tUnderstands and supports the High Country Bank Mission Statement and commits to adhere to High Country Banks Values of Honesty, Excellence, Accountability, Respect and Together.
\tResponsible for processing loan payments received for all loans, including setting up automatic payments.
\tResponsible for maintenance on all existing loan accounts, such as but not limited to: address changes, payment errors, and ARM maintenance.
\tResponsible for all line of credit transactions, such as but not limited to: monitoring HELOC end of draw periods, pay to zero requests, and processing line of credit advances.
\tPay and record all disbursements of funds from impound accounts, such as but not limited to: taxes, insurance, flood, PMI, and USDA payments.
\tEnsure each required loan has a proper insurance policy in place by working directly with our third-party servicer.
\tManages returned loan department mail..
\tMonitors tax payments and status for all applicable loans by working directly with our third-party servicer.
\tResponsible for completing an escrow analysis each year for our active portfolio loans.
\tResponsible for issuing loan payoff quotes and performing the maintenance of releasing collateral on all paid off loans.
\tMonitors and takes action on any disputes received, corrections needed, and overall reporting requirements to the credit bureaus.
\tResponsible for taking action on error resolution requests received for all loans.
\tPrepares and sends borrower(s) all foreclosure notices according to department policies and procedures.
\tGenerates and monitors various servicing related loan reports.
\tPulls and sends the required event letters for all loans.
\tResponsible for answering phone calls related to our loan portfolio and loans sold on the secondary market.
\tResponsible for secondary market loan servicing to include, but not be limited to: monitoring interest rate lock dates, selling mortgage loans on the secondary market, completing all secondary market and internal post-closing maintenance once a loan has been sold on the secondary market, and transferring loans through the MERS system.
\tResponsible for construction portfolio maintenance and monitoring to include, but not be limited to: reconciling and approving all construction draws, processing all construction draws, and monthly construction loan inspections.
